VAI Daily Aug. 25, 2025 Final FAA AD: Leonardo A109, A119, and AW119 MkII This FAA airworthiness directive (AD), which takes effect Sep. 9, applies to A109A, A109AII, A109C, A109K2, A119, and certain AW119 MkII helicopters. It requires checking for proper installation of the bolts that attach the pitch actuator assembly and the roll actuator assembly to their respective bell crank assemblies in the cyclic control system. VAI Daily Aug. 22, 2025 Final FAA AD: Airbus EC120B, EC130 B4, and EC130 T2 This FAA airworthiness directive (AD), which takes effect Sep. 26, requires inspecting for the presence of the retaining ring in the emergency flotation system (EFS) inflation assembly and taking corrective action, if necessary. It also prohibits the installation of an EFS with certain inflation assemblies. VAI Daily Aug. 22, 2025 How the Bell AH-1Z Viper improved on the AH-1W (The National Interest) – The US Marine Corps recently phased out the long-serving Bell AH-1W SuperCobra in favor of the AH-1Z. The Viper, which has a four-bladed composite rotor, can carry heavier payloads, integrate with drones, and deploy weapons with increased stability. « First« Previous…1112131415…203040…Next »Last »
